Air Quality Index (AQI) level in 2010 was 19.1. This is significantly better than average.
Particulate Matter (PM10) [µ/m3] level in 2010 was 17.9. This is better than average. Closest monitor was 18.9 miles away from the city center.
Particulate Matter (PM2.5) [µ/m3] level in 2004 was 14.7. This is worse than average. Closest monitor was 24.3 miles away from the city center.
Sulfur Dioxide (SO2) [ppb] level in 2003 was 3.62. This is about average. Closest monitor was 18.0 miles away from the city center.

Religion statistics for Statesville (based on Iredell County data)
Percentage of population affiliated with a religious congregations: 50.11%
| Here |  | 50.1% |
| USA |  | 50.2% |
Breakdown of population affiliated with a religious congregations
| Name | Southern Baptist Convention | United Methodist Church | Catholic Church | Presbyterian Church (USA) | Evangelical Lutheran Church in America |
| Adherents | 42.8% | 22.3% | 8.0% | 6.8% | 4.4% |
| Congregations | 29.1% | 22.6% | 1.0% | 10.1% | 3.5% |
|---|
| Name | Association Reformed Presbyterian Church | Church of God (Cleveland, Tennessee) | Churches of Christ | Episcopal Church | Other |
| Adherents | 3.7% | 2.4% | 1.8% | 1.2% | 6.7% |
| Congregations | 4.5% | 5.0% | 2.5% | 1.5% | 20.1% |
|---|
Source: Jones, Dale E., et al. 2002. Congregations and Membership in the United States 2000. Nashville, TN: Glenmary Research Center. Tables represent county-level data.
